AI Analysis & Value Prop

In the industrial sector, there is a growing concern over energy efficiency and product quality, particularly in refrigeration systems. Currently, many manufacturers face challenges in identifying seal integrity issues, which can lead to increased energy consumption and product malfunction. Existing solutions often rely on manual inspections, which are time-consuming and prone to human error. The Refrigerator Door Seal Leakage Detection Dataset aims to address these challenges by providing a large and diverse set of images for training machine learning models to automatically detect seal deformities and detachments. The dataset was collected using high-resolution cameras in controlled environments, ensuring clarity and consistency. Quality control measures included multiple rounds of annotations, consistency checks, and expert reviews to ensure accuracy. The data is organized in JPG format, with images labeled according to seal status and quality metrics. This systematic approach guarantees that the dataset meets the high standards required for effective model training.

Technical Specifications

FieldTypeDescription
file_namestringFile name
qualitystringResolution
door_seal_statusstringDescribes whether the refrigerator door gasket is deformed or detached.
defect_locationstringThe location where the defect in the refrigerator door gasket appears.
defect_typestringThe specific type of defect in the refrigerator door gasket, such as deformation or detachment.
defect_severitystringDescribes the severity of the door gasket defect, such as minor, moderate, or severe.
door_seal_materialstringThe specific material used to manufacture the refrigerator door gasket.
seal_colorstringInformation about the color of the refrigerator door gasket.
environmental_conditionsstringThe environmental conditions at the time of shooting, such as lighting and background.
defect_sizefloatThe size of the defect in the door gasket.
image_qualitystringDescribes quality information such as the clarity and contrast of the image.

Why does refrigerator door seal misalignment affect equipment energy efficiency?
Misalignment of refrigerator door seals can cause cold air leaks, increasing the refrigerator's energy consumption. Therefore, detecting and repairing misalignment issues is an important step in improving equipment energy efficiency.
